Katy No-Pocket by Emmy Payne

Another childhood favorite!

Katy, a kangaroo, is sad because she doesn't have a pocket to carry her little joey in like all of the other mother kangaroos do.

She decides to ask all of the other animal mothers how they carry their babies to see if one might work for her. None seem to be able to help until ash speaks to an owl who tells her to try going to the city to see if she could buy a pocket.

In the city, she encounters a kindly construction worker who is wearing an apron with a BUNCH of POCKETS! This kindly man, upon hearing of Katy's troubles, instantly dumps the tools from his apron and gives it to Katy. 

She is no longer "Katy no pocket". She has more pockets than any other Kangaroo mother in the world!

A sweet story.
